#64410e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#64410e is composed of 39.2% red, 25.5%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 35% magenta, 86%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 35.6 degrees, a saturation of 75.4% and a lightness of 22.4%. #64410e color hex could be obtained by blending #c8821c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

● #64410e color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#64410e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#64410e has RGB values of R:100, G:65,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.35, Y:0.86,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6570254.

Shades and Tints of #64410e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0902 is the darkest color, while #fffdf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#64410e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3d3a35 is the less saturated color, while #714301 is the most saturated one.
